description abstract | A framework is developed within which linguistic assessments of seismic loads and structural damage can be assigned fuzzy set representations. This involves a set of rules in the form of a language organized in an algorithmic manner. Factors that affect the function of language elements are discussed and the use of the language is shown in an example. It is concluded that the developed framework enables linguistic assessments about seismic loads and associated structural damage to be concisely and consistently represented in terms of fuzzy sets. | |
